I have a Solaris 2.8 Sparc server. I want to install snort in that. But, the available version of Snort for that is Solaris 2.7(sparc). Can that be used...?? Will it create any problems..?? Or, with slight modifications can it be used..?? If so, what r the changes..??
Download the tarball, uncompress, untar, cd into the snort-1.8.3 directory, ./configure && make && make install (as root). Should work fine. If you need a .pkg for it, roll your own. Check out the contrib directory, there's a script that will packagize the snort binaries for you to ship out.
